Aims and Scopes

The journal 'Science China-Information Sciences' focuses on the intersection of information science and technology, emphasizing innovative research and applications in various fields. It aims to publish high-quality articles that contribute to the advancement of knowledge in these domains.
  1. Information Processing and Control Systems:
    Research on algorithms and methods for information processing, including adaptive control systems, event-triggered control, and distributed consensus protocols for multi-agent systems.
  2.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ning:
    Development and application of AI and machine learning techniques, particularly in areas such as reinforcement learning, deep learning, and their integration into various systems.
  3. Quantum Computing and Cryptography:
    Exploration of quantum algorithms, quantum key distribution, and secure communication protocols, reflecting the growing interest in quantum technologies.
  4. Neuromorphic Computing and Hardware Design:
    Innovations in neuromorphic devices and computing architectures, focusing on energy-efficient designs and their applications in artificial intelligence.
  5. Communication Systems and Networks:
    Research on communication protocols, network optimization, and the integration of emerging technologies such as 5G and beyond, with a focus on efficiency and reliability.
  6. Robotics and Autonomous Systems:
    Studies on the control and operation of autonomous systems, including UAVs and multi-robot systems, emphasizing adaptive and resilient behaviors in dynamic environments.
  7. Data Science and Analysis:
    Advancements in data-driven methodologies for analysis, including big data processing, privacy-preserving techniques, and the application of statistical methods in various domains.
The journal 'Science China-Information Sciences' is witnessing a surge in research themes that align with contemporary technological advancements and societal needs. These emerging areas are indicative of the journal's responsiveness to current trends in science and technology.
  1. Artificial Intelligence for Autonomous Systems:
    A notable increase in research focusing on integrating AI into autonomous systems, particularly regarding their decision-making processes and adaptive behaviors.
  2. Quantum Information Science:
    Significant growth in publications related to quantum algorithms, quantum cryptography, and their applications, reflecting the rapid development in this cutting-edge field.
  3. Smart and Secure Communication Technologies:
    Emerging research themes in communication systems that emphasize security, efficiency, and the integration of AI and machine learning for enhanced performance.
  4. Neuromorphic and Bio-inspired Computing:
    A rising interest in neuromorphic computing architectures that mimic biological processes for improved computational efficiency and energy savings.
  5. Data Privacy and Security in AI:
    Growing focus on methodologies that ensure data privacy and security while leveraging AI, particularly in the context of federated learning and differential privacy.
  6. Resilient Control Systems:
    Increasing research on robust control strategies that can withstand external disturbances and cyber-attacks, particularly in the context of multi-agent systems and cyber-physical systems.

Declining or Waning

While certain themes continue to thrive, some areas of research within 'Science China-Information Sciences' appear to be declining in prominence. This may reflect shifts in research focus or the maturing of specific technologies.
  1. Traditional Computing Paradigms:
    Research related to classical computing methods and architectures is becoming less prevalent, as the focus shifts towards more advanced paradigms like quantum computing and neuromorphic systems.
  2. Basic Theoretical Studies in Control Theory:
    While foundational work in control theory remains important, the journal has seen a decrease in purely theoretical papers, indicating a growing emphasis on practical applications and real-world implementations.
  3. Conventional Security Protocols:
    As new cryptographic techniques and quantum-safe methods emerge, traditional security protocols based on classical mechanisms are receiving less attention, reflecting the need for more robust solutions.
  4. Static Network Design:
    Research focusing on static or less adaptive network designs is waning, as the emphasis shifts towards dynamic, self-optimizing networks that can adapt to changing conditions.
